Preferential solvation of ions in mixed solvents—III. Conductance studies of some 1:1 electrolytes in N,N-dimethylformamide + methanol mixtures at 25°C.
1985
Abstract Equivalent conductances of Bu 4 NNO 3 ,AgNO 3 and KI in methanol (MeOH) and those of Bu 4 NBPh 4 ,Bu 4 NNO 3 , Bu 4 NI, Agno 3 and KI in several N,N -dimethylformamide + methanol (DMF + MeOH) mixtures over the entire solvent composition range have been measured at 25°C.The conductance data in all the cases have been analysed by the Shedlovsky method.Evaluation of limiting ion conductances (λ 0 i ) and hence the solvated radii ( r i ) of ions in DMF + MeOH mixtures shows a homoselective preferential solvation of Bu 4 NBPh 4 , Bu 4 NNO 3 and Bu 4 NI with the cation Bu 4 N + and the anions Ph 4 B − , NO − 3 and I − all being selectively solvated by MeOH. AgNO 3 and KI, on the other hand, are heteroselectively preferentially solvated with Ag + and K + being preferentially solvated by DMF and NO − 3 and I − preferentially solvated by MeOH.
